Sink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, contained water damage | Yes | No | You can handle small messes on your own. |
| Large water damage or widespread flooding | No | Yes | Professionals have the equipment and expertise to handle large-scale damage. |
| Water damage in a crawl space or attic | No | Yes | These areas can be difficult to access and need specialized equipment. |
| Visible m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ew need specialized cleaning and removal techniques. |
| Water damage to electrical systems or appliances | No | Yes | Electrical systems and appliances need specialized handling to prevent further damage or safety risks. |

Sink Overflow Water Removal Cost In Wellesley, MA
The cost of sink overflow water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Wellesley, MA.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the extent of the damage and the necessary repairs. Factors that affect the cost include: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500-$1,500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200-$1,000 | Extent of water damage and cleaning required |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000-$5,000 | Severity of damage and materials needed |
| Final inspection and clearance | $100-$500 | Complexity of the job and number of inspections required |
